Costa Rica-Heredia
Hybrid Roles:
Key Responsibilities
Application Leadership:Manage and support core manufacturing applications (e.g. MES, Training, Equipment Management), ensuring high availability, performance and alignment with operational needs
Project Management:Lead end-to-end development and implementation of new systems and upgrades, including requirements gathering, vendor selection, integration, testing and rollout
System Optimization:Identify opportunities to improve system efficiency, data accuracy and user experience through automation, customization and integration
Vendor Management:Coordinate with external vendors and service providers to ensure timely delivery, support and compliance with SLAs
Compliance and Security:Ensure applications meet regulatory requirements (e.g. FDA, ISO) and follow cybersecurity best practices
Qualifications
Bachelor’s degree in Computer Science, Information Systems, Engineering or related field
5+ years of experience in IT application management within a manufacturing environment
Strong knowledge of manufacturing systems such as MES, preferably Siemens Opcenter CORE
Experience with cloud platforms (AWS, Azure, etc), system integration, data application architecture and process automation
Familiarity with continuous improvement methodologies or lean manufacturing concepts
Excellent communication, problem-solving and project management skills
Ability to work in a fast-paced, cross-functional environment
Preferred Skills
Experience of working in a regulated industry like Medical Devices or Pharma
Experience with Industry 4.0 technologies (IoT, predictive maintenance, digital twins) and AI
Knowledge of data platforms (like Snowflake)
Software validation and automated testing methodologies and tools
Certifications in PMP, ITIL, or relevant technologies
Multinational or multi-site manufacturing experience

France-Voisins le Bretonneux
Governance and strategy
• Represent Boston Scientific in local trade associations (e.g., SNITEM) to ensure alignment with evolving industry codes and regulations
• Chair the local compliance committee in France, driving effective governance and timely decision-making
• Lead the annual risk assessment process by partnering with the Country Leadership Team to identify and prioritize key compliance risks
• Drive the strategy and execution of Annual Country Compliance Plans, aligning initiatives with risk assessments and compliance objectives
• Track progress of key initiatives, report on compliance KPIs, and escalate material risks as appropriate
Culture and partnership development
• Partner closely with the Country Leadership Team in France to embed compliance into commercial and operational strategies
• Act as a visible compliance ambassador and business partner, fostering a speak-up culture and ethical decision-making
• Design and deliver engaging compliance training and communication programs tailored to various levels of the organization
• Collaborate cross-functionally with Legal, Commercial Divisions, HR, Finance, and other stakeholders to ensure proactive, solution-oriented compliance
• Represent France in regional and global compliance forums to share local insights and ensure alignment across business units
Operational support
• Serve as the primary point of contact for review and approval of HCP/HCO interactions in France and the EMEA Proctor Bureau
• Ensure documentation, due diligence, and approvals are compliant with internal controls, SOPs, and MedTech/local codes
• Provide expert-level advice on complex compliance scenarios, including high-risk and non-standard cases
• Deliver timely, pragmatic guidance on both local and international compliance policies (e.g., MedTech Europe Code, Anti-Gift Law)
• Monitor and drive continuous improvement of compliance systems, workflows, and internal controls
• Mentor and support junior compliance professionals and business partners to build internal compliance capabilities
Required qualifications:
• Minimum of 7 years' experience in compliance, legal, or a related field, preferably within the medical device, pharmaceutical, or healthcare sector
• Deep understanding of local and international healthcare compliance regulations, including MedTech Europe Code and Anti-Gift Law
• Proven ability to lead cross-functional initiatives and influence senior stakeholders
• Strong analytical, problem-solving, and decision-making skills
• Excellent communication skills in both English and French
• Familiarity with compliance systems and tools used in multinational organizations
• Previous experience supporting operational compliance activities or anti-bribery/anti-corruption audit activities across EMEA
